The Global Allyltrimethylammonium Chloride Market was valued at USD 152.4 Million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 254.6 Million by 2032, growing at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.5% during the forecast period (2024–2032). This robust expansion is propelled by escalating demand from the water treatment, polymer, and personal care industries, alongside significant industrial growth in the Asia-Pacific region.

As industries increasingly prioritize high-performance specialty chemicals and sustainable manufacturing, the role of key producers of allyltrimethylammonium chloride becomes paramount. This quaternary ammonium compound is essential for creating cationic polymers used in diverse applications. 🌍 Outlook: The Future of Allyltrimethylammonium Chloride is Driven by Innovation and Sustainability

The allyltrimethylammonium chloride market is undergoing a significant transformation. While traditional applications in water treatment and polymers continue to dominate, the industry is increasingly focused on sustainable production methods and the development of high-value applications in electronics and pharmaceuticals.

📈 Key Trends Shaping the Market:

  • Growing demand for bio-based and green chemistry alternatives in Europe and North America

  • Increasing regulatory pressure for environmentally benign quaternary ammonium compounds

  • Expansion of production capacities in Asia-Pacific to meet global demand

  • Technological advancements in purification and synthesis for higher efficiency
